The southbound right lane of state Route 7 in Steubenville will close from 7 a. m. to 3 p. m. Thursday for maintenance work, according to the city's public works department.
Traffic will continue to flow in the left lane, and motorists are advised to exercise caution and remain alert for changes in traffic patterns. Meanwhile, MonPower has announced a planned power outage for approximately 227 customers in the Rabbit Hill Road area on Tuesday from 8 a.
m. to 2 p. m. Crews will perform essential maintenance during this time. This outage, originally scheduled for an earlier date, may be postponed again depending on weather conditions.
